Saginaw 4 Speed Conversion Parts List
Just acquired a 1970 C10 Fleetside. It has a 350 in it with 3 on the tree. Looking to eliminate the 3 on the tree with a used 4 speed Saginaw tranny from my buddy. Just was wondering what sorts of major things I'll be running into with swapping this in. I'm 99% positive that the tranny will bolt right up. Just wondering about drive shaft lengths, Yolks, Floor shifter location and things of that nature. Any advice and or help is greatly appreciated. Thanks

Re: Saginaw 4 Speed Conversion Parts List
The Saginaw four speed and Saginaw three speed are the same case and overall length, so no issues with trans crossmember location or driveshaft length.
You'll need to decide what floor mounted four speed shifter you want to use (Hurst Indy or whatever) and decide how much of the column claptrap you want to strip off. I removed the column shift handle and cut the remaining nub off the collar, placing my Sun tach on the column to cover the hole. K

Re: Saginaw 4 Speed Conversion Parts List
sorry to dig up a grave.. i haven't logged in in a long while. i have been reading and reading about driveshafts. im switching from Saginaw 3 to 4 speed and the 3 is 17in the 4 is like 21 1/4 front to tall. Not the same cases at all. any one else have a swb 4 Saginaw??? whats your drive shaft length please???
